在具有6块硬盘的服务器配置RAID时,最优选的RAID配置方案通常是RAID 10或RAID 6,具体分析如下:
1、RAID 0
性能提升:通过数据条带技术,将数据分布在多个硬盘上,大幅提升读写速度。
无冗余性:不提供数据冗余,因此不适合对数据安全性有高要求的应用场景。
2、RAID 1
数据镜像:通过镜像技术,将数据完全复制到另一块硬盘,实现数据冗余。
读性能优化:读取数据时可以并行从两个硬盘读取,提升读速度。
成本与写入性能:磁盘利用率低,成本较高,且写入速度稍慢,因数据需同时写入两块硬盘。
3、RAID 5
奇偶校验:采用一块硬盘的容量来存放奇偶校验信息,实现数据恢复功能。
成本效益:相比RAID 1提高了磁盘利用率,成本相对较低。
性能考虑:适用于读多写少的场景,因为写入数据需计算并更新校验信息。
4、RAID 6
双重奇偶校验:采用两块硬盘的容量来存放奇偶校验信息,即使两块硬盘同时故障也能保证数据安全。
最高冗余性:提供了最高的数据保护能力,适用于数据安全要求极高的场合。
磁盘利用率:由于需要两块硬盘存储校验信息,磁盘利用率低于RAID 5。
5、RAID 10
组合优势:结合了RAID 1的数据镜像和RAID 0的数据条带技术,既有良好的读写性能也保证了数据冗余。
适用环境:适合对读写性能和数据安全性都有较高要求的高端服务器环境。
成本考量:磁盘利用率较低,因为至少需要4块硬盘来实现此配置。
6、其他RAID级别
RAID 2, 3, 4:这些RAID级别较少使用,因为其性能、冗余性和成本效益不如其他常见的RAID配置。
在选择合适的RAID配置时,管理员应考虑以下因素:
重要性与预算:评估数据的重要性及可分配给存储系统的预算。
读写性能需求:根据应用的读写模式选择适当的RAID类型。
容错需求:确定数据丢失风险下的容错需求,选择合适的冗余级别。
未来扩展性:考虑长期存储需求,选择便于未来扩展的配置。
对于拥有6块硬盘的服务器而言,RAID 10通常为最佳选择,因为它综合了性能和冗余性,如果预算有限或对数据恢复能力有极端要求,可以考虑RAID 6,RAID配置的选择应基于业务需求、预算限制以及对性能和数据安全性的考量。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/934535.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复